Topics

 

  • Abnormal prenatal images with a good prognosis
  • Brain imaging for children with cCMV
  • Genetics and congenital CMV -for the better or for the worse ?
  • Hearing in children with congenital CMV – from antiviral treatment to hearing rehabilitation
  • Maternal markers of non-primary infection
  • Noninvasive diagnosis of fetal infection in primary and non-primary infections
  • Novel biomarkers in amniotic fluid – can it tell severity at the time of diagnosis of fetal infection ?
  • Novel drugs to prevent and to treat congenital infection
  • Unrecognized long term sequel in asymptomatic children – from vestibular problems to autistic spectrum disorder
  • Vaccines to prevent congenital CMV
  • Other

Guidelines

Please follow the following structure:

1. SELECT THE TOPIC
Enter the AUTHORS NAME
Enter the AUTHORS INSTITUTIONAL AFFILIATIONS
Enter the PRESENTER FULL NAME

2. ABSTRACT TITLE

3. CONTENT – MAXIMUM 500 WORDS (including spaces)
INTRODUCTION
METHODS
RESULTS
CONCLUSIONS

4. FIGURES/TABLES (2 images or one image and one table are allowed)
Image (optional) in JPEG or PNG format.

Important notes: Authors should quote figures and tables in the text and should number them in the order in which they appear in the text. Each figure and table should be accompanied by a short description- Regarding references, please list the references in order of citation in the text, in square brackets. For each entry, please clearly indicate the following data: names of all the authors, title of the article/book, publication year. Moreover, for journal articles, indicate journal title, volume, issue, first and last page of the article; for websites, indicate the last access; for books, indicate the book publisher and its head office. If you want to quote a chapter within a book, please add information on the chapter (title and authors).

 

Conflict of interest statement

Please provide a conflict of interest statement. In case of human experimentation, please indicate which ethical standards were followed and write an informed consent statement; in experiments on animals, please indicate an animal rights statement.
